Internet Protocol Addresses

An Internet Protocol (IP) address is a number automatically assigned to your computer whenever you access the Internet. This number does not identify your name, e-mail address or other Personal Information. If you request information from this Website, our server will enter your IP address into a log. We use this information to measure Website traffic, to help us to understand how people are using our Website and to hopefully improve your online experience.

This Website may gather certain non-personal information through the use of “cookies”. Cookies are a technology which can be used to provide you with tailored information from a Web site. A cookie is an element of data that a Web site can send to your browser, which may then store it on your system. You can set your browser to notify you when you receive a cookie, giving you the chance to decide whether to accept it. Please be aware however, that some parts of this Website may no longer function properly if cookies are disabled
